Description
Technical Field
The utility model relates to a toolbox technical field especially relates to a toolbox is used in electrical equipment installation convenient to carry.
Background
The toolbox is a box used for storing various tools with different functions and functions, is convenient to use, manage and maintain, and along with the continuous development of economy and the change of ideas, the requirements of a user on the toolbox are higher and higher, so that the appearance of the toolbox is changed greatly, the toolbox is also innovated continuously in material use, and the toolbox is convenient to store and is easier to manage and carry.
However, in the case of a tool box used by an electrician, the placing of tools is too many, and the electrician cannot quickly find the required tools.
SUMMERY OF THE UTILITY MODEL
The utility model aims at solving the defects existing in the prior art and providing a portable tool box for electrical equipment installation.
In order to achieve the above purpose, the utility model adopts the following technical scheme: a portable tool box for mounting electrical equipment comprises a first bucket, two second buckets and two third buckets, wherein the first bucket, the two second buckets and the two third buckets are provided with two folding mechanisms, each folding mechanism comprises two first hinge rods, the bottoms of the two first hinge rods are hinged with the first buckets, the top ends of the two first hinge rods are respectively hinged with the corresponding second buckets, the two second buckets are hinged with second hinge rods, the top ends of the two second hinge rods are respectively hinged with the corresponding third buckets, the second buckets and the third buckets on the same side are hinged with the same third hinge rod, the bottom end of the third hinge rod is hinged with the first buckets, the two first hinge rods are hinged with fourth hinge rods, the two fourth hinge rods are hinged with the same vertical rod, and the two third hinge rods are hinged with fifth rods, one end of each of the two fifth hinged rods, which is close to each other, is hinged to the vertical rod.
Preferably, the top ends of the two vertical rods are fixedly welded with the same round rod.
Preferably, welded fastening has first articulated piece on the montant, and the one end that two fifth articulated rods are close to each other all articulates with first articulated piece mutually.
Preferably, the third bucket is hinged with a protective cover.
Preferably, welded fastening has the articulated piece of second on the montant, and the one end that two fourth articulated rods are close to each other all articulates with the articulated piece of second mutually.
Preferably, the two second buckets are close to each other and one side and the two third buckets are close to each other, and permanent magnets are fixed to the two second buckets and one side in a welding mode.
Compared with the prior art, the beneficial effects of the utility model are that: when the tool in the tool box is used, the round rod is only required to be pressed towards the first bucket, the round rod drives the vertical rod to move downwards, the vertical rod drives the two fourth hinged rods and the two fifth hinged rods to rotate around the second hinged block and the first hinged block respectively and to be away from each other, the two fourth hinged rods drive the corresponding first hinged rods to rotate around the first bucket as a circle center and to be away from each other, so that the two second buckets are away from each other, meanwhile, the two fifth hinged rods drive the two third hinged rods to rotate around the circle center and to be away from each other, so that the two third buckets are away from each other, so that the first bucket, the two second buckets and the two third buckets are completely opened, a user can select the required tool according to needs, when the tool is not used, the round rod is only required to be lifted upwards, and then the two second buckets and the two third buckets are close to each other, the permanent magnets corresponding to each other are attracted together, so that the tools in the tool box can fall out.

Drawings
Fig. 1 is a schematic view of the three-dimensional structure of the present invention;
fig. 2 is a schematic front view of the structure of the present invention;
FIG. 3 is an assembly view of the hinge of the present invention;
in the figure: 1. a first bucket; 2. a first hinge lever; 3. a second bucket; 4. a third bucket; 5. a second hinge lever; 6. a third hinge rod; 7. a vertical rod; 8. a round bar; 9. a protective cover; 10. a fifth hinge lever; 11. a fourth hinge lever.

Referring to fig. 1-3, the present invention provides a technical solution: a portable tool box for mounting electrical equipment comprises a first bucket 1, two second buckets 3 and two third buckets 4, wherein the first bucket 1, the two second buckets 3 and the two third buckets 4 are provided with two folding mechanisms, each folding mechanism comprises two first hinge rods 2, the bottom ends of the two first hinge rods 2 are hinged with the first bucket 1, the top ends of the two first hinge rods 2 are respectively hinged with the corresponding second buckets 3, the two second buckets 3 are respectively hinged with second hinge rods 5, the top ends of the two second hinge rods 5 are respectively hinged with the corresponding third buckets 4, the second bucket 3 and the third bucket 4 which are positioned on the same side are hinged with the same third hinge rod 6, the bottom end of the third hinge rod 6 is hinged with the first bucket 1, the two first hinge rods 2 are respectively hinged with fourth rods 11, and the two fourth hinge rods 11 are hinged with the same vertical rod 7, the two third hinge rods 6 are hinged with fifth hinge rods 10, and the ends, close to each other, of the two fifth hinge rods 10 are hinged with the vertical rod 7;
